Prayer

Spend some time in silent prayer with God. You can use the PRAY acronym below to guide you.

  • P: Praise – Spend some time thanking God for who He is in your life.
  • R: Real life – Spend some time engaging God about your real needs and concerns.
  • A: Ask – Ask for God’s provision, love, and power to be made known to people in your life.
  • Y: Your will – Spend some time being silent and listening for God’s direction.
